Specific heat (heat capacity) WebMay 22, 2024 · Enthalpy is represented by the symbol H, and the change in enthalpy in a process is H 2 – H 1. There are enthalpy formulas in terms of more familiar variables such as temperature and pressure: dH = C p dT + V(1-αT)dp. Where C p is the heat capacity at constant pressure and α is the coefficient of (cubic) thermal expansion. For ideal gas αT ...

WebIf the coefficients of the chemical equation are multiplied by some factor, the enthalpy change must be multiplied by that same factor (ΔH is an extensive property). The enthalpy change of a reaction depends on the physical state of the reactants and products of the reaction (whether we have gases, liquids, solids, or aqueous solutions), so ...
